In general I've found the cities in west Michigan (minus GR and exclusive summer spots) to be dying. Kalamazoo has a decent setting, but if WMU wasn't here it would be a ghost town. Attempts to keep residents in the area by offering assistance with education as long as they kept kids in public schools has still not made up for the absence of any jobs beyond the university in the area. Another college town that provides its residents with a mall to work at, and several service jobs. Chain restaurants, boring nightlife and lots of commercial beer.
